DMAIL briefly surged to $0.7444, up nearly 40% intraday
On February 19th, according to market data, DMAIL briefly surged to $0.7444 and has now slightly fallen to $0.7264, with an intraday increase of nearly 40%. Dmail posted on social media yesterday claiming to be one of the earliest dApps to integrate login functionality for Worldcoin users, providing Web3 email services for users.
